// REINDEX_BATCH_CAP limits docs per shard pass in the Tallowfield
// nightly search reindex. Raising it starves the ingest queue;
// lowering it overruns the maintenance window. 5000 is the tested
// sweet spot. Change only with a soak run. Verified against the
// build noted below.

session token of bawif-hahog = htk6_ac5981

# Contacts — Murmur Audio Guide

On-call: Murmur serves the Hallowfen Museum audio-guide app. Playback outages page you directly; content errors (wrong exhibit narration, missing translations) do not — route those to the curation team via their queue. CDN issues belong to the streaming rotation. Escalate only if visitor-facing downtime exceeds ten minutes. For anything ambiguous during your shift, ask the guide platform leads first.

escalation mailbox, hahaf-tadup: oliath.sorwyn@paliqsys.corp

## Releases

Quick note for support: FormulaBox (the sandbox that runs user-supplied formulas) ships as its own release artifact, separate from the main Calcutron app. If a customer reports formulas failing after an upgrade, check that their sandbox version matches the release matrix — mismatches are the usual culprit. Every release tarball is signed, and you can verify it yourself before telling a customer it's legit. Verification is one command with our public key, which is included here for reference.

rollout seal: bky4_x7Gc

Step 4: Cron Drift Check (Quartzline Scheduler). Before redeploying the Quartzline agent, confirm the host clock offset against the Tellurix NTP pool; any drift over 200ms explains the skipped midnight jobs. Once drift is ruled out, rebuild the agent from the pinned tag and push it through the Harvane deploy channel. The deploy key for that channel is below.

rollout seal: bky4_yke3